* {{BFS}}: The story takes place during the brief surge of popularity for the giant beam sabers pioneered by the ZZ Gundam, which could also be used as heavy-duty beam cannons when 'sheathed'. Several suits have them mounted, including the FAZZ team, the S/EX-S Gundam, and the Gundam Mk. V (the last of which gets particularly good use out of them thanks to its extreme mobility).

* CallForward: The Gundam Mk. V was created as the predecessor to the Doven Wolf from ''Anime/MobileSuitGundamZZ''. Though out of universe it was designed much later, in-universe it's a SuperPrototype whose design was simplified and mass-produced by Neo Zeon after ''Sentinel's'' ending.
